First Serve OKC Foundation, founded in 2013, is a small nonprofit in the Recreation & Sports sector that reported $479K in total revenue in fiscal year 2023. Revenue surged 29% from the prior year, signaling strong growth momentum. Expenses of $436K left a modest 9% surplus.

Mission

STRENGTHENING THE LIVES AND ENHANCING THE CHARACTER OF OKLAHOMA CITY YOUTH THROUGH TENNIS AND EDUCATION.

THE COMPETITIVE PROGRAM WAS CREATED FOR OUR STUDENTS WHO DESIRE TO PLAY COMPETITIVE TENNIS BUT CANNOT AFFORD TO DO SO. TO QUALIFY FOR THIS PROGRAM, STUDENTS MUST HAVE A FINANCIAL NEED, PLAY IN COMPETITIVE TOURNAMENTS, ATTEND PRACTICE 3 TIMES PER WEEK, AND COMPLETE COMMUNITY SERVICE. IN 2023, WE HAD 90 STUDENTS IN THIS PROGRAM. THIS PROGRAM FOCUSES ON LIFE SKILLS, ON-COURT TENNIS INSTRUCTION, AND HEALTHY SNACKS.

THE COMMUNITY PROGRAM IS THE FURTHEST REACHING IN ITS SCOPE. IN 2023, WE SERVED 796 STUDENTS AT 24 OKC PUBLIC SCHOOLS & COMMUNITY SITES. THE PROGRAM AIMS TO TEACH BEGINNER TENNIS IN 6-WEEK SESSIONS AND EACH SESSION CONSISTS OF 4 TO 5 ELEMENTARY SCHOOLS. AT THE SESSION'S END, THE SCHOOLS COME TO THE OKC TENNIS FOR A TENNIS PARTY. WE WORK WITH ORGANIZATIONS LIKE FREEDOM CITY OKC, PITTS PARK, POSITIVE TOMORROWS, & THE OKC INDIAN CLINIC.

THE PITTS PARK PROGRAM WAS ESTABLISHED IN JUNE 2023 AS OUR FIRST "COMMUNITY HUB". PITTS PARK IS A RECREATION CENTER LOCATED IN NORTHEAST OKLAHOMA CITY WITH TWO TENNIS COURTS AND A COMMUNITY CENTER. OUR PROGRAMMING INCLUDES ON-COURT TENNIS INSTRUCTION, LIFE SKILL LESSONS, AND EDUCATIONAL TUTORING. ALL PROGRAMMING IS PROVIDED FREE OF COST. IN 2023, WE SERVED 83 STUDENTS.
